    The capital is becoming more and more prosperous and lively.

    The end of the year is just around the corner, and the servants of rich families are everywhere, and carriages are returning laden with all kinds of New Year's goods, ranging from rouge gouache for the ladies in the inner courtyard, maids, maids, and grandmothers, to various pork, mutton, firecrackers, and dried fruits.  People from poor families are not idle either. They wander around in the cheapest shops for a long time with the little bits of silver and copper coins they have saved from a year of hard work. They grit their teeth and stamp their feet and carefully take them out, and pull a few feet of coarse cloth for the mother-in-law or children at home.  Make new clothes, cut half a catty of pork belly in the butcher shop and take it home to make dumplings

    Both the poor and the rich are busy for this New Year. The word "New Year" has been passed down for thousands of years. Now it is more than just a festival. It seems to have become a sacred ritual for the people of the Ming Dynasty, and it is also a kind of salvation and peace for their families.  indulgence.

    The entire Qin Mansion was also filled with joy and celebration.

    The money sent by Zhu Houzhao and Xu Pengju was naturally misappropriated by Qin Kan. The Qin Mansion could finally have a good year. Du Yan was very happy. How could she let the housekeeper handle such an upright shopping and purchasing opportunity?  Naturally, it was up to the mother of the Qin family to take action on her own.

    So Du Yan has been busy these days. As soon as the city gate opened early in the morning, Du Yan sat in a small sedan, holding a small box of cash in her hand, followed by two large carriages and entered the city. Qin Kan also  Instead of worrying about her being robbed, Qin Kan felt that he should worry about her mother-in-law robbing others when she found out that she didn't have enough money when purchasing, so he told her before going out that she would come back when the money was gone.  Don't steal other people's money

    When rumors circulated in the city that people would just take and leave without paying for shopping, Qin Kan¡¯s supermarket was also busy preparing.

    The things sold there were not unusual, but the business philosophy definitely exceeded everyone's imagination in this era. Qin Kan felt a little unsure. After all, the survival environment of a supermarket must be under the premise of good social atmosphere and strict laws.  Strong support. Today's Ming Dynasty generally has a good social atmosphere, especially in the imperial city of the capital. Although it is not as exaggerated as not closing the door at night and not picking up lost things, no one dares to challenge the king's law easily. What's more, this shop has the Prince of the East Palace, Duke Wei and Jin Yiwei.  Three layers of background.

    Rumors abounded, under the expectant gaze of countless people, and under the uneasy mind of Qin Kan, the first supermarket in Ming Dynasty finally opened in the inner city.

    On the twenty-fifth day of the twelfth lunar month, the auspicious day of the zodiac, firecrackers were blasting and gongs and drums were noisy at the North Street Market in the inner city. Countless people gathered around to watch. As the red silk on the signboard was torn off, several black people of the "Da Ming Wanhuo Store" appeared.  There were gold characters on the bottom, the rope hanging horizontally in front of the door was lowered, and countless people rushed in.

    Qin Kan, Zhu Houzhao, and Xu Pengju were standing not far away. The three of them were smiling. However, Qin Kan's smile was a bit forced and he remained silent.

    Zhu Houzhao smiled and felt something was wrong, so he asked the question that Qin Kan had been worried about: "Hey, have you noticed that these people don't look like they are shopping when they go in? Their expressions don't seem to intend to give anything."  Money."

    Xu Pengju also nodded repeatedly.

    Qin Kan sighed sadly, even these two extremely nervous guys could see something was wrong, proving that his worries were not unnecessary.

    It¡¯s still the same idea - we should really call those Jin Yiwei gangsters who helped spread the news and line up to strangle them one by one!  If you only say half a paragraph of a complete propaganda, it will kill people.

    "Ding Shun, hurry up and transfer the brothers and the Shuntian government officials!" Qin Kan turned around and shouted, with an angry look in his eyes: "How dare you take my things without giving me money? Do you think I'm running a charity hall to do welfare work?"  ?¡±

    Ding Shun hurriedly turned around and ran away.

    As expected, not long after, shouts and curses came from the store. Many people held up the goods in the store and cursed angrily at the dozen or so big men who blocked them.  They formed a wall of people with faces on their faces, blocking those who wanted to take their things and go out directly.

    "The boss said you can only go out after paying, unless you don't buy anything!" A big man shouted with a red face.

    "Fart! The whole city said that after your store opened, you just took whatever you liked and took it away. Why do you want us to pay now? Are you honest?"

    "Paying money when buying something is a matter of course. How can there be any reason to just take it and leave? What does it have to do with our boss if you believe the rumors? If you don't want to pay, you can just put your things down and I will let you out."

    ¡°¡­¡­¡­¡­¡±

    Qin Kan stood in the distance, feeling relieved in his heart.

    Ding Shun finally got it right. A dozen strong men picked from nowhere worked. Well, it¡¯s time to give them money for processing.

    &However, the reputation was not very good, which led to the following few days of neglect, and no one dared to come to the door again.

    The propaganda methods prepared by Qin Kan from his previous life began to show their power.

    First of all, we must instill a concept into the people of the city - you have to give money to buy things. No matter which dynasty or generation, this is a rule that has not changed for thousands of years. Unless the people of the Ming Dynasty ushered in communism, it will not matter if they lose a penny.  .

    The following propaganda methods dazzled the people of the capital.

    An overwhelming number of small leaflets were spread out, detailing the unit prices of various products, new openings for the new year, discounts and special events, how much the original price of something was, and how much it was after the discount. They were listed clearly and clearly, compared with the current price.  After the market price of Ming Dynasty, the housewives of ordinary people in Ming Dynasty who knew how to live a careful life naturally started to care.

    The promotional slogan is very tempting. No matter who you are, you will definitely get a discount when you enter the store, and you will never break your promise.

    People soon discovered that this slogan was indeed true.

    If you go in and buy something sincerely, all the goods in the store will be discounted. If your hands and feet are unclean and dare to steal things, you will still get a discount, but it will be a discount on your hands.

    Such cheap and integrity, shops that say discounted discounts are not responsible for their pockets.

    After a small turmoil in its opening, the Daming Variety Store has quietly become prosperous in the capital.
